Camera System: AI-Enhanced Imaging
The Samsung Galaxy S24 boasts a highly capable and versatile triple-camera system, featuring a 50MP main sensor, 12MP ultrawide, and a 10MP 3x optical telephoto lens. Its computational photography, powered by the S24's NPU, already delivers excellent results across various lighting conditions, with features like enhanced Nightography and AI-powered editing tools.
The Galaxy S25 is expected to build upon this strong foundation with potential hardware improvements, possibly including a larger main sensor for better light gathering and dynamic range, or refined optics for the ultrawide and telephoto lenses. Crucially, the S25's more powerful NPU will likely unlock a new generation of AI-driven camera features, offering even more sophisticated computational photography, advanced video stabilization, and potentially new generative AI editing tools that go beyond what the S24 can achieve.
While the S24 remains a top-tier camera phone in 2026, the S25 is poised to take a definitive lead, particularly for those who prioritize the absolute best in mobile photography and videography, especially with the integration of cutting-edge AI enhancements.
Battery Life & Charging: Efficiency Gains Expected
The Samsung Galaxy S24, with its 4000 mAh battery, offers respectable but not class-leading endurance. Most users can comfortably get through a full day, but heavy usage often necessitates a midday top-up. Charging speeds are adequate, typically reaching 50% in about 30 minutes with a compatible charger.
The Samsung Galaxy S25 is expected to feature a slightly larger battery capacity, potentially in the range of 4100-4200 mAh. More significantly, its next-generation processor is anticipated to offer substantial efficiency gains, meaning more work can be done with less power. This combination of a larger battery and a more efficient chipset should translate to noticeably improved overall battery life.
While charging speeds are unlikely to see a dramatic leap, the S25's expected gains in endurance will be a welcome improvement for users seeking more consistent all-day power. For those who frequently push their phone to its limits, the S25 will likely alleviate some of the battery anxiety that S24 users might occasionally experience.
Value for Money: The S24's Enduring Appeal
The Samsung Galaxy S24 launched at an attractive price point of $799.99, offering a premium flagship experience. By 2026, with the S25 on the market, the S24's price will have naturally depreciated, making it an incredibly compelling value proposition. You'll be acquiring a device that still feels incredibly modern, performs exceptionally well, and benefits from Samsung's extended software support, all for a potentially significant discount.
Conversely, the Samsung Galaxy S25 is expected to launch at a higher price, likely in the $849-$899 range, reflecting the cost of new components and inflationary pressures. While it will offer incremental improvements in performance, camera, and AI, these gains come at a premium. For many, the marginal benefits won't justify the hundreds of dollars saved by opting for its still-excellent predecessor.
In 2026, the Galaxy S24 undeniably represents the superior value. It delivers 90% of the S25's experience for potentially hundreds of dollars less, making it the smarter financial choice for savvy consumers who prioritize performance and features over having the absolute newest model.
